Catharine T. Hartman

Catharine T. Hartman, 96, of Lebanon, PA, passed away Monday, July 19, 2010 at Cedar Haven Nursing Home.

She was the wife of the late Joseph H. Hartman.

Catharine was born in Lebanon, PA on March 21, 1914. She was a daughter of the late Stephen B. & Christina M. (Allwein) Gress.

She was a retired flower designer from Royer's Flower Shop.

She was a member of St. Mary's Church. She enjoyed bowling, reading, sewing and crocheting.

She is survived by six children, Mary Ann, wife of William Fields, Joseph T. Hartman, Patricia M., wife of Joseph Noll, Lawrence A. Hartman, Thomas P., husband of Linda Hartman, and Kathleen D., wife of Ellwood Smith, all of Lebanon; eighteen grandchildren, twenty five great grandchildren and two great great gr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by a daughter, Elizabeth Gingrich and a sister, Christine Siegrist.
